The festival planned for Saturday, June 25 has been canceled with ticket refunds expected to be issued in the coming weeks.

The top of the bill had been scheduled to be led by Spanish-language superstars such as J Balvin, Kali Uchis, and Becky G. It was also slated to be one of Daddy Yankee’s last performances after announcing his retirement earlier this year. Other legendary Mexican acts, such as Paquita la del Barrio, Los Tucanes de Tijuana and El Fantasma, had also been scheduled to perform.
